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ville vs. Virginia College-Knoxville
Both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ville and Virginia College-Knoxville are 2-4 years schools located in Tennessee. The following statements compare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ville and Virginia College-Knoxville with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Virginia College-Knoxville's tuition ($15,550) is more expensive than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ville ($5,137).
- Virginia College-Knoxville's students to faculty ratio (12 to 1) is lower than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ville (20 to 1).
-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ville (1,581 students) is larger than Virginia College-Knoxville (453 students) with more enrolled students.
-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ville ($2,904) has higher amount of financial aid than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Knoxville ($2,904).
- Both schools have same graduation rate of 71%.
